Description: This will be a noxious weed identification and removal trip on Mt Lemmon. We hope to check in on and pull some yellow bluestem, dalmatian toadflax, spotted knapweed and maybe a few more listed invasive plant species. Several of these species are not found elsewhere in southern Arizona so this is a chance to learn some new plants in a cooler climate while also supporting the Forest Service to protect the Catalinas.
